Sound
Projector
Technology
The TV's bank of speakers can be adjusted to reflect
sound off the room walls to create a surround sound
effect.
Setup can be performed manually and/or automatically,
depending on your TV model:
Manual setup only
151 series
Manual or Auto setup
153 series
To create the surround sound effect, the room walls
must reflect sound and not be covered with sound-
absorbant material.
Repeat the setup procedure if you reconfigure the
room's walls or furnishings.
Before
You Begin
Pos!tioning
the TV
Center the seating area in front of the TV and at
least six feet away from it.
Arrangements
that give good results:
Connecting
the TV
To get the full benefit of the TV's Sound Projector, the
TV must be connected
to a source input providing
digital surround sound. The TV can receive digital sur-
round sound on:
Any HDMIjack
The DIGITAL AUDIO INPUT jack (when used in
conjunction
with INPUT 2)
The ANT input (from some digital broadcasts)
See page 19 for suggestions on connecting
your
devices.
Basic
Setup
Note:
153 Series.
If you have already performed Auto
setup, any manual adjustments
will erase all
settings created during Auto setup.
1,
Press MENUand go to Initia! > SoundPro.
Press
ENTER to enter the menu.
Enter the room dimensions
and layout information
requested in the screen. To change measure-
ments, press ,& V.
If the room is an odd shape, locate the TV to take
best advantage of wall reflections.
3_
4,
Press MENUto exit.
Play some sample audio to check sound quality.
If further adjustment is needed, use the Custom
menu as described below.
Avoid locations that may distort sound reflections.
Custom
Menu
Use the Custom
menu after defining the room layout.
For a room with large areas of curtains that might affect
sound reflection, do the following:
a.
Open the curtains fully to improve sound reflec-
tion.
b.
Set angles by performing the procedure in
"Adjusting Beam Angles."
